Data needed at a solar site
Useful solar monitoring combines generation data, inverter status, irradiance, weather conditions, cabinet temperature and communication health. Together these signals reveal underperformance faster than monthly billing data.
Connectivity choices
RS485 / Modbus is common between meters, inverters and weather sensors. A gateway then uploads data by 4G, Ethernet or LoRaWAN depending on site network conditions.
Operational outcomes
Operators can compare expected and actual yield, identify downtime, dispatch cleaning or repair work and report portfolio performance to customers or investors.
